HBP trailer

International teaser trailer for Harry Potter and the Half-Blood Prince shows all new footage. As Harry begins his sixth year at Hogwarts, Lord Voldemort wreaks havoc throughout Britain, and the pressure to defeat him grows stronger. Using an old Potions book which previously belonged to the Half-Blood Prince, Harry is able to increase his magical knowledge and prepare for battle. First, however, he must help Dumbledore discover the secret to Voldemort’s quest for immortality — the location of his Horcruxes. But the quest for the Horcruxes and the resulting battle at Hogwarts produce a tragic outcome — leading Harry to believe he must head out on his own to conquer the Dark Lord.

Article in a magazine :

The evidence of her success is compelling. At nine years old, she was among thousands of girls vying to play the coveted role of Hermione and her eagerness to thrive at the character slowed down shooting during Harry Potter and the Philosopher’s Stone.

“I wanted everything to be so perfect. I would work so hard to memorize my lines and the scene; we would have to stop shooting because I was mouthing Rupert [Grint]’s and Dan [Radcliffe]’s lines at the same time. That’s something I had to get over.”

Seven years later, the young actor has graduated to blockbuster star status. She’s learned to position herself in her best light, she’s stopped looking straight into the camera, she knows the different between the key grip and a dolly, and she’s just wrapped one of her most challenging scenes in the highly anticipated Harry Potter and the Half-Blood Prince, slated for release in July 2009.

“I had to cry for the first time when Hermione watches Ron kiss Lavender. It was difficult to bring up all that emotion and hurt in front of a full crew, and not just once, but over and over again from different angles.”
